Sr Data Center Engineer needs 5 years experience performing maintenance and installation of mission critical infrastructure systems in a Data Center.

Sr Data Center Engineer requires:
  • Good collaboration skills with proven experience engaging with and partnering with peers and stakeholders. Experience providing IT technical customer support.
  • Good written and oral communication skills.
  • Knowledge of IT infrastructure hardware, including their designs, uses, repair and maintenance.
  • Ability to use DCIM and CAD software to aid in data center white-space capacity planning.
  • Solid Microsoft Office skills and experience using Collaboration software such as Microsoft Teams/SharePoint and Zoom.
  • Capability to work in a physically demanding environment.
Sr Data Center Engineer duties:
  • Design and prepare data center white space to ensure power, space, cooling (airflow/temperature), and infrastructure standards are met.
  • Provide general IT Infrastructure skills with a systematic approach to troubleshooting equipment issues.
  • Provide process execution for data center IT asset lifecycle management from installation to operational support, and ultimately asset retirement. Installation/de-installation of network cabling throughout data center and similar hardware; ensures PII data is handled within guidelines.
  • Manages daily workload and after-hours support of on-site cable vendors. Consists of both physical project instructions as well as issuing operational work requests via Service Now.
  • Move equipment, racks, and materials between physical locations in the same data center.
  • Creates CAD templates and sets new design standards for High-Density deployments.
  • Generates/distributes reports connected to the operation of a data center.
  • Provide support to engineers to understand VLAN and network requirements for new IT infrastructure technologies.
  • Perform Asset Management tasking in Configuration Management Database (CMDB) and maintain CAD and Data Center Infrastructure Management (DCIM) elevation/floorplan data.
  • Prepares electrical quotes and manages circuit installation, prepares cabinets with power distribution, and maintains PDU schedules.
  • Acts as the first point of contact for connectivity, power, cooling anomalies and perform on-call roles on a rotational basis.
